MAPREDUCE服务 MRS-自定义Hive表行分隔符:操作场景
操作场景
通常情况下,Hive以文本文件存储的表会以回车作为其行分隔符,即在查询过程中,以回车符作为一行表数据的结束符。但某些数据文件并不是以回车分隔的规则文本格式,而是以某些特殊符号分隔其规则文本。
MRS Hive支持指定不同的字符或字符组合作为Hive文本数据的行分隔符,即在创建表的时候,指定inputformat为SpecifiedDelimiterInputFormat,然后在每次查询前,都设置如下参数来指定分隔符,就可以以指定的分隔符查询表数据。
set hive.textinput.record.delimiter='';
当前版本的Hue组件,不支持导入文件到Hive表时设置多个分隔符。
- MapReduce服务_如何使用MapReduce服务_MRS集群客户端安装与使用
- MapReduce服务_什么是Hive_如何使用Hive
- 大数据分析是什么_使用MapReduce_创建MRS服务
- MapReduce服务_什么是存算分离_如何配置MRS集群存算分离
- MapReduce服务_什么是Hue_如何使用Hue
- MapReduce服务_什么是Loader_如何使用Loader
- Hudi服务_什么是Hudi_如何使用Hudi
- MRS备份恢复_MapReduce备份_数据备份
- MapReduce服务_什么是MapReduce服务_什么是HBase
- ModelArts自定义镜像_自定义镜像简介_如何使用自定义镜像